Panasonic announce TH-AX100 HD Ready LCD Projector in Japan.
The Panasonic TH-AX100 home cinema projector sports some hot specs: 6,000:1 contrast ratio and 2,000 Ansi lumen brightness.
The currently available Panasonic TH-AE900 has 1,100 lumen. This is a great improvement and should allow you to enjoy movies normal lit rooms.This sounds like a new hot choice for a budget home cinema. Open questions are the price and the noise level.
Panasonic will start selling the TH-AX100 on October 10th.
